Here are some key points to consider when it comes to jacket hanging:
- Choose the Right Hanger: Opt for hangers that are sturdy and designed for jackets. Wooden or padded hangers are often recommended as they provide better support.
- Space it Out: Avoid overcrowding your closet. Give each jacket enough space to hang freely to prevent unwanted wrinkles.
- Use Pegs Wisely: If using pegs, ensure they are placed at an appropriate height to avoid stretching the fabric.
- Keep it Clean: Regularly clean your hangers and pegs to prevent dust accumulation that can transfer to your jackets.
- Organize by Season: Consider rotating your jackets based on the season, making it easier to access what you need.
